    Hello Anne, my name is Marco and I am an Independent Advisor. I will do my best to help you.

    Try these steps to fix this error.

    Step 1.

    • Click Start and start typing on your keyboard for "services.msc"
    • In your search results "services.msc" should show up. Open it with a click.
    • A new windows will open containing all Windows services on your system.
    • Search for "Windows Update"
    • Right-click the "Windows Update" and then click Stop.

    Step 2.

    • Hold your windows-key pressed and hit "R" key simultanous.
    • A small new windows will appear.
    • Type %windir%\SoftwareDistribution\DataStore in this new window and click OK.
    • This will open Windows Explorer on the correct location.
    • Delete all contents of this folder. (Hint: Use Ctrl + A to select all files and folders)

    Step 3.

    Return to services.msc and instead of stop, select start.

    Check if it ok now...
